High-Efficiency Ethylene Compressors from China Factory - Leading Suppliers for Ultra-Low-Temperature Applications

As a leading supplier in China, our factory produces core power equipment essential for the cryogenic separation process in ethylene plants. This advanced compressor is engineered for exceptional low-temperature adaptability, ensuring stable operation even at extreme temperatures as low as -115°C. Utilizing specialized low-temperature materials, it effectively prevents brittle fracture, enhancing safety and reliability. Our high-efficiency centrifugal compression technology, combined with innovative sealing solutions, results in a higher compression ratio, improved efficiency, and reduced energy consumption, far surpassing conventional compressors. With a remarkable service life of 15 to 20 years, this equipment meets the stringent demands of ultra-low-temperature refrigeration and operational safety in ethylene production.     Ethylene Diaphragm Compressor Advantages
    01
    Absolutely Oil-Free & Ultra-High Purity Assurance
    The diaphragm isolation technology ensures that the gas is 100% free from contact with lubricating oil during compression, achieving a compression purity of over 99.999%. This is critical for "polymer-grade" ethylene used as a polymerization feedstock, where even trace oil contamination can affect catalyst activity, leading to product quality degradation or even polymerization failure.
    02
    Static Seal Zero Leakage & Intrinsic Safety
    The entire gas chamber employs a static seal structure, fundamentally eliminating the possibility of gas leakage. For ethylene, which has a wide explosion limit and high hazard level, this feature provides the highest level of safety assurance, effectively preventing the accumulation of flammable gas in the plant area and meeting the most stringent safety production and environmental protection requirements.
    Key Design Points for Ethylene Diaphragm Compressors
    01
    Precise Anti-Liquefaction & Temperature Control Design
    Given that the critical temperature of ethylene (9.21°C) is close to ambient temperature, it is highly prone to liquefaction during compression and cooling, which can cause "liquid slugging." The design must include accurate thermodynamic calculations to ensure that the discharge temperature and the gas temperature after inter-stage cooling always remain above the dew point at the corresponding partial pressure, with a sufficient safety margin. The cooling system must be efficient and reliable to prevent gas condensation within the chamber or piping.
    02
    High-Pressure & Material Compatibility Design
    To meet the demands of processes such as ultra-high-pressure polyethylene synthesis, the compressor must adopt a multi-cylinder series arrangement or a specially reinforced structure to achieve discharge pressures exceeding 100 MPa. Materials for wetted parts are typically selected as 316L stainless steel or higher-grade alloys to ensure high-pressure strength while providing excellent chemical inertness, preventing any adverse reactions with ethylene. The use of copper and its alloys is strictly prohibited to avoid catalyzing the formation of hazardous polymers from ethylene.
    03
    Multi-Layered Safety Monitoring & Protection System
    A three-layer diaphragm structure is standard, equipped with a diaphragm rupture monitoring and alarm device. If the inner diaphragm is damaged, the system can immediately trigger an alarm and safely shut down. The system must integrate interlocks such as high discharge temperature and pressure alarms, as well as oil pressure protection. For process connections, nitrogen purge connections should be to allow for inerting and purging of the system before startup, ensuring safe operation.

    Model Selection
    GZ
    Model G70Z/G95Z/G110Z/G130Z Piston Stroke 70mm~130mm
    Maximum Piston Force 10KN~30KN Maximum Discharge Pressure 70Mpa
    Flow Range 1~500Nm³/h Motor Power 2.2KW~30KW
    Crankshaft Speed 420rpm Cooling Method Water Cooled/Air Cooled
    GV
    Model G70V/G95V/G130V Piston Stroke 70mm~130mm
    Maximum Piston Force 10KN~30KN Maximum Discharge Pressure 50Mpa
    Flow Range 1~200Nm³/h Motor Power 2.2KW~30KW
    Crankshaft Speed 420rpm Cooling Method Water-cooled / Air-cooled
    GL
    Model G110L/G130L Piston Stroke 110mm~130mm
    Maximum Piston Force 20KN~40KN Maximum Discharge Pressure 100Mpa
    Flow Range 10~1000Nm³/h Motor Power 7.5KW~90KW
    Crankshaft Speed 420rpm Cooling Method Water-cooled / Air-cooled
    GD
    Model G110D/G130D/G150D/G180D/G182D/G210D Piston Stroke 110mm~210mm
    Maximum Piston Force 20KN~160KN Maximum Discharge Pressure 100Mpa
    Flow Range 30~2000Nm³/h Motor Power 22KW~200KW
    Crankshaft Speed 420rpm Cooling Method Water-cooled / Air-cooled
